This chickpea millet rice is a simple yet satisfying recipe that utilizes cooked millet, chickpeas, and vegetables to create a hearty, one-pot meal in just 30 minutes. This recipe is perfect for making the most of leftover millet and turning it into a quick weekday lunch or dinner.
With just a few basic spices and fresh ingredients, you'll have a wholesome meal that fits beautifully into lunchboxes or serves as a fuss-free dinner.

Detailed Steps
Here are the step-by-step photos to guide you through making this quick and easy millet stir-fry recipe.

Step 1: Heat oil in a pan and sauté green chilies and ginger until fragrant.

Step 2: Add finely chopped beans.

Step 3: Then add the chopped carrots and cook until they are slightly tender.

Step 4: Stir in the cooked chickpeas, followed by salt. Here I used black chickpeas, but regular white chickpeas also go well in this recipe.

Step 5: Mix in the cooked millet and gently combine everything until heated through.

Step 6: Finish with chopped cilantro before serving.

Recipe

Chickpea Millet Rice - Quick Leftover Millet Stir Fry

Ingredients
- 1 cup carrots finely chopped
- 1 cup green beans finely chopped
- 3 green chilies or jalapenos
- 1 inch ginger
- 1 cup chickpeas cooked or canned, I used black chickpeas
- 2 cups cooked millet
- 1 tablespoon oil
- ¼ cup cilantro finely chopped
- Salt to taste
Instructions
- Heat oil in a pan and sauté green chilies and ginger until fragrant.3 green chilies, 1 tablespoon oil, 1 inch ginger
- Add chopped carrots and beans, then cook until slightly tender.1 cup carrots, 1 cup green beans
- Stir in the cooked chickpeas and add salt to taste.1 cup chickpeas, Salt to taste
- Add the cooked millet and mix gently to combine all the ingredients.2 cups cooked millet
- Garnish with chopped coriander and serve warm.¼ cup cilantro
Notes
Tested Tips from My Kitchen
- For best results, use leftover millet, as it mixes well without becoming mushy.
- Cook millet ahead of time using my Instant Pot Millet or Rice Cooker Millet recipes.
- Adjust chilies based on spice preference.
- Other vegetables like green peas, bell pepper, or sweet corn also go well in this dish.
- Even without the addition of sauces, this stir-fry will still taste delicious. Ginger and green chili will flavor the millet very well.
